What will the role involve?
In this 5 years program sitting as part of our Investments Division, our Pre‐contract Commercial and Estimating Team (PCC&E) provide pre‐contract commercial and estimating support on bidding opportunities across all the Amey Group.
- Assist with the commercial evaluation of tender documentation on specific bids
- Assist and support the estimating process on specific bids.
- Assist with the implementation of pricing strategy
- Assist with the risk management on specific bids
- Participate in tender review processes
- Capture data to support the wider PCC&E team on bid work
- Development of tender metrics from opportunities and lessons learnt workshops
- Support the PCC&E team regarding managing bid pipelines and future planning
- To assist the PCC&E Team in carrying out their normal commercial and pricing duties, in complying with the Amey Values, and in ensuring high success rate in bidding whilst ensuring the business is not exposed to undue commercial risk.

Duration
This apprenticeship program will last over the course of 5 years
Location
Your based location is currently Oxford, however is may change to London or Birmingham.
You will be required to attend university at least 1 day per week during term time, universities will be either be in Bristol or Reading depending on your preference.
Additional Information
Successful apprentices will achieve a Degree in Surveying and full chartered membership of the RICS. The degree will incorporate vocational and academic elements.
